Large Language Models (LLMs) are impressive, but their massive size makes them computationally expensive and slow. One major bottleneck is the "KV cache," a memory store that helps LLMs process information quickly. But this cache itself can become a drag on performance. Researchers have introduced a new technique called AlignedKV to tackle this issue. Instead of storing all the information in the KV cache with the same level of detail, AlignedKV cleverly adjusts the precision of the stored data based on its importance. Think of it like compressing an image – you can reduce the file size without losing crucial visual information. AlignedKV does something similar, keeping only the essential bits for less critical data points, which reduces the amount of data that needs to be read from memory. This precision-aligned quantization leads to faster memory access, speeding up the LLM's attention mechanism without sacrificing accuracy. In tests, AlignedKV cut down memory access by 25% and sped up attention calculations by up to 1.3 times in LLMs like Llama-2-7b. As LLMs continue to grow, techniques like AlignedKV are crucial for keeping them fast, efficient, and accessible.

How does AlignedKV's precision-aligned quantization work to optimize LLM performance?
AlignedKV uses adaptive precision storage in the KV cache by adjusting data precision based on importance. The process works in three main steps: 1) It analyzes the importance of different data points in the KV cache, 2) Applies varying levels of precision - higher precision for crucial information and lower precision for less critical data, and 3) Optimizes memory access patterns for faster retrieval. This is similar to how JPEG compression works in images, where more important visual details retain higher quality. In practice, this allows LLMs like Llama-2-7b to achieve 25% reduced memory access and 1.3x faster attention calculations without compromising model accuracy.
